Over the past few days, the Altcoin Season Index has dropped from 43 to 25, signaling a shift in cryptocurrency market dynamics. Bitcoin’s recent performance affects the current market landscape. The Altcoin Season Index dropping to 25 suggests a Bitcoin-dominant market phase. This shift indicates changes in market preferences towards Bitcoin over other cryptocurrencies. Bitcoin’s Surge to $100K Boosts Market Dominance The Altcoin Season Index measures whether the market leans towards altcoins over Bitcoin. As of May 16, the index shows that Bitcoin is outperforming most altcoins. This reflects a shift from the previous situation when altcoins demonstrated stronger performance. Falling from 43 to 25, the index highlights Bitcoin’s regained dominance. This change can be attributed to Bitcoin’s recent price surge past the $100,000 mark, affecting altcoin valuations as investors refocus on Bitcoin. CoinMarketCap reports Bitcoin trading at $104,052.98 with a market cap at $2.07 trillion and 62.05% dominance as of May 16, 2025. BTC’s 30-day price surged by 24.35%, reinforcing its current position as a dominant force in the crypto market. Bitcoin(BTC), daily chart, screenshot on CoinMarketCap at 06:51 UTC on May 16, 2025.
